A scientific diagnosis for adult ADHD is not a basic "pass/fail" test. It is an intricate mental and medical evaluation developed to eliminate other conditions and verify the presence of ADHD signs since childhood. Many private centers follow a standardized multi-step process.
1. Pre-Assessment Screening
Before meeting a clinician, the person is usually asked to finish a number of confirmed self-report scales. Typical tools consist of the ASRS (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ale) or the Weiss Functional Impairment Rating Scale.
2. Informant Reports
ADHD is a developmental condition, indicating signs need to have existed before the age of 12. Clinicians often request that a parent, sibling, or long-term partner complete a survey relating to the person's habits in youth and their adult years.
3. The Clinical Interview
This is the core of the assessment. A psychiatrist or expert psychologist will conduct a deep dive into the person's biography. They search for proof of symptoms across numerous settings, such as work, home, and social life. The majority of private suppliers use the DIVA-5 (Diagnostic Interview for ADHD Adult Assessment UK in Adults) to ensure they meet the criteria laid out in the DSM-5.
4. The Diagnostic Report
Following the interview, the clinician puts together the evidence. If a medical diagnosis is verified, the private gets an official report. This document is crucial for accessing medication and seeking "sensible adjustments" under disability legislation, such as the Equality Act 2010 in the UK.
Finding a Provider "Near Me": Key Considerations
When searching for a regional provider, it is important to guarantee the clinic fulfills extensive medical requirements. Not all private assessments are viewed equally by public health bodies or insurer.
Professional Credentials
The assessment must be performed by a certified professional. In the UK, this usually implies a Consultant Psychiatrist or a Specialist Nurse Practitioner registered with the GMC (General Medical Council) or NMC (Nursing and Midwifery Council). If seeking a mental method, the professional need to be signed up with the HCPC (Health and Care Professions Council).
Area and Accessibility
While numerous private assessments are now conducted via protected video link (telehealth), some individuals choose face-to-face consultations. Discovering a center "near me" can be helpful if physical medical examination (like high blood pressure and heart rate monitoring) are required before beginning medication.
Shared Care Agreements
This is a vital factor for those looking for a private assessment in the UK. A "Shared Care Agreement" (SCA) permits a private specialist to handle the preliminary diagnosis and "titration" (the process of discovering the right dosage of medication), after which the GP takes over the recommending at basic NHS rates.
Note: Individuals must always check if their local GP is willing to accept a private medical diagnosis before booking an assessment, as some GP practices have policies against this.

Q: Can I get a private assessment if I am currently on an NHS waiting list?A: Yes. Lots of people pick to spend for a private assessment to get immediate responses while remaining on the NHS list for long-lasting care or therapy.
Q: Is a private medical diagnosis "official"?A: Provided the assessment is brought out by a certified clinician (Psychiatrist or Clinical Psychologist) using acknowledged diagnostic tools (DSM-5 or ICD-11), it is a lawfully and clinically valid diagnosis.
Q: How long does a Private ADHD Assessments assessment take?A: The clinical interview generally lasts between 90 minutes and 3 hours. The last report is usually delivered within 1 to 2 weeks following the appointment.
Q: Will my insurance coverage cover the expense?A: Some private medical insurance suppliers cover the diagnostic assessment, but numerous omit "persistent neurodevelopmental conditions." It is necessary to inspect the particular policy information.
Q: What happens if I move home?A: If the assessment was carried out by a registered professional, the medical diagnosis remains valid. Nevertheless, if medication is being handled through a Shared Care Agreement, a new GP in a various area might need to re-approve the contract.
